[Biological features of the spring soft wheat in the conditions of northern forest-steppe of Western Siberia and their use in selection]
2007
Lichenko, I.E. | Lichenko, N.N.
The theory of parental pairs matching and selection of experimental lines is developed. It is established that the influence of a genotype on variability of the growth period duration is slightly; a defining role is played by the ecological conditions. The early-maturing varieties with the extended period from shoots to a heading have some advantages of productivity. For the selection estimation in the conditions of favorable humidifying it is necessary to use indicators of leaf weight in a flowering time since they correlate closely with the grain weight in an ear. The ratio of shoots weight in a ripening stage to their weight at the moment of flowering is at new high-yielding varieties considerably higher than at the released varieties. A potential mass of 1000 grains is a little influenced with the condition of growth. This index of new generation forms is higher than at released varieties. The indicators of productivity and production quality are influenced positively with the earlier terms of sowing. The early-ripening varieties are notable for the increased glassiness. The gluten content is higher in the case of the sowing after the fallow and at the sowing in early times. The spring soft wheat varieties Zlatozara and Cherniava 13 adapted to the Western Siberia conditions and possessing of the complex of economic and biologically useful features are bred. They are sent to the State quality testing and they are registered in the State Registry. The varieties Provincia and Bel are bred and transferred to the State quality testing as well.
